When will Samsung Dictionary adopt the OneUi design language? It still has no dark mode. No rounded search bar. And the icon is also the same as the TouchWiz days. by Reader1997 in oneui

[–]Reader1997[S] 5 points6 points  (0 children)

It's the only dictionary you can instantly use when surfing through a web page in any web browser. When you long-tap a word, in the 3 dot menu you have a dictionary option. This is the dictionary app it leads to. It opens in a 2 inch pop up on the bottom of your screen and shows the word's meaning.

There is no alternative to what this app does.😢 It has existed since TouchWiz and samsung isn't putting any effort in refining its ui. It's in a constant light mode.
